Protecting GNSS from Manipulation

As the reliance on GPS/GNSS continues to grow for all aspects of PNT (Position, Navigation, Timing), so do the amount and sophistication of jamming and spoofing attacks. Cyber terrorists using fairly low tech spoofers and open source software can easily deploy spoofers that deliver a bogus GPS/GNSS signal and can attack and cripple mission critical equipment relying on GNSS timing or a critical infrastructure such as a telecoms network, a financial institute or a power station. Spoofing cases are well documented in the media, be it at the national level such as Russia manipulating GPS signals around the Russian President or this list that discusses just some of the thousands of GPS spoofing attacks recorded in 2020.
